Sofitel Mauritius L'Imperial Resort & Spa - Flic en Flac
-20.31175, 57.36775The elegant Sofitel Mauritius L'Imperial Resort & Spa Flic en Flac, situated just 8 minutes' walk from Wolmar Public Beach, entices guests with a tennis court, a terrace, and various recreational opportunities. The 5-star luxury resort is located in the charming part of Flic en Flac, at a distance of 4.9 km from Speedomax go-Kart Track, which is a quite popular sporting attraction.
Location
Notable for its location, approximately 10 minutes by car from Tamarina Golf Course in the Flic-en-Flac Beach district, the luxurious property is about 25 minutes' walk from Flic en Flac Beach. The Sofitel Mauritius L'Imperial Resort & Spa Flic en Flac is also nestled in a garden and a tropical garden, really close to Public Beach 2. A private beach is around 10 minutes by car from the elegant accommodation, while The Martello Tower Museum is situated around 6 km away.
For those travelling from afar, Sir Seewoosagur Ramgoolam airport is 49 minutes' drive away.
Rooms
Looking onto the patio, some rooms at the Sofitel Mauritius L'Imperial Resort & Spa offer soundproof windows furnished with a sofa and a writing table. Guests can make use of a mini fridge bar and tea/coffee making equipment, and relax with free Wi-Fi and a flat-screen TV with satellite channels. For more comfort, hair dryers and bath sheets, along with a Jacuzzi bath and a sauna, are provided. Here you'll also find views of the Indian Ocean.
Eat & Drink
The Sofitel Mauritius L'Imperial Resort & Spa Flic en Flac offers breakfast in the restaurant. The à la carte restaurant has a spacious terrace. A range of tasty drinks can be enjoyed at the beach bar. Choose from an unlimited choice of Asian dishes at Ginger Thai which is a few minutes' drive from this Flic en Flac hotel.
Leisure & Business
At the property you may pay for a swimming pool and massage therapy. An infinity pool as well as a gym highlight the Sofitel Mauritius L'Imperial Resort & Spa Flic en Flac. Boasting a wellness area and a spa lounge, the accommodation also features a tennis centre on site. Beauty treatments at this Flic en Flac property include body scrub, pedicure, and manicure along with spa amenities such as a Turkish steam room, a Turkish bath, and an outdoor swimming pool. A conference space and meeting rooms with a photocopy machine and a work desk are available for those travelling for business.
